Abstract
- The present absolute isotope abundance measurements of Ca in Ca-Al-rich inclusions from the Allende and Leoville meteorites show the extreme rarity of nonlinear isotope effects in Ca, in sharp contrast to the endemic effects in Ti. The Ca in the Ca-Al-rich inclusions shows mass-dependent isotope fractionation effects whose range is a factor of 20 wider than the range previously established for bulk meteorites and for terrestrial and lunar samples. A correlation is found between Ca and Mg isotope fractionation effects and inclusion type, and a possible correlation between isotope fractionation and rare earth element abundance patterns is discussed.
